histone H2AT120 kinase activity [GO_1990244]

Catalysis of the reaction: histone H2A-threonine (position 120) + ATP = histone H2A-phosphothreonine (position 120) + ADP. This reaction is the addition of a phosphate group to the threonine residue at position 120 of histone H2A.

Note that the residue position corresponds to the canonical human H2A2A histone (UniProtKB:Q6FI13); this residue is conserved across all eukaryotes, but corresponds to T119 in Drosophila and S121 in yeast and Tetrahymena. Residue 1 is the first residue following removal of the initiating Methionine (Met). Note that each histone is encoded by multiple genes, and sequences may vary across different genes within an organism.
